Ignatios Souvatzis writes:
> Oh... I didn't look, maybe there isn't a MI 53C80 driver yet.

There's some MI 5380 code in sys/dev/ic, and that's what the
sun3's ncr-driver (si.c) and thus port-vax also are using...

> Look at sys/dev/ic/ for the lance or the esp driver, for an example of
> a core driver, and at sys/arch/sparc/dev/I_THINK_esp.c, for a
> frontend.

To me it seems that there's ncr53c9x (sparc's esp-driver uses that)
and a ncr5380 (built into 2000 and 3100) which is used in sun3's si-
driver and some/many others (atari, mac, hp300 and other 68k machines).
>From what I remember 5380 drivers fall into two categories:
	- using MI 5380 (ncr5380sbc)
	- doing all from scratch
But away from the before-mentioned si-driver for sun3/sun3x I don't
remember any "generic" frontend for nc5380.
